The Mortgage Assumption Agreement Form in Alameda is a legal document that facilitates the transfer of a property from one party (Grantor) to another (Grantee) while allowing the Grantee to assume any existing mortgage obligations associated with the property. Key features include the identification of the parties involved, the property details, the specifics of the lien and mortgage being assumed, and a provision for indemnifying the Grantor. Completion of the form requires inputting essential information such as the purchase date, property location, and mortgage details. Users should ensure the consent from the lender is addressed, as it may be a crucial factor in the assumption process.
